The California Public Employees’ Retirement System (CalPERS), established in 1932 and headquartered in Sacramento, California, is the largest public pension fund in the U.S., managing over $510 billion in assets as of late 2024 to provide retirement and health benefits to more than 2 million state and local government employees, retirees, and their families. Operating as a defined benefit plan, CalPERS invests globally across equities, fixed income, real estate, private equity, and infrastructure, guided by a 13-member board and a commitment to sustainable investing and ESG (environmental, social, governance) principles under Chief Investment Officer Ben Meng since 2024. Known for its influential shareholder activism—pushing for corporate governance reforms—CalPERS serves over 3,000 employers, including state agencies and school districts, balancing long-term funding needs with a $100 billion unfunded liability challenge. As a cornerstone of California’s public sector, it blends financial stewardship with a mission to secure retiree livelihoods.

California Public Employees Retirement System's Q2 2013 Portfolio in Review

Q2 2013 is the first quarter with a 13F filing on record for California Public Employees Retirement System, which disclosed 3,996 positions worth $49.8B. Its ten largest holdings account for 14% of the portfolio.

Its largest position is ExxonMobil: 12,356,604 shares worth $1.12B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 16% of assets, followed by Technology and Healthcare.
